How does car parking at the Luton Airport work?

Car parking at London Luton Airport is divided into several car parks, each offering different options and prices. Here's a general overview of how car parking works at Luton Airport:

1. Pre-booking: It is recommended to pre-book your parking space online in advance to secure your spot and potentially get better rates. You can make a reservation through the airport's website or via third-party parking companies.

2. Car Parks: Luton Airport has several car parks, including short-stay car parks for quick drop-offs and long-stay car parks for longer stays. The car parks are located either within walking distance of the terminals or a short bus ride away.

3. Arrival: Upon arriving at the airport, follow the signs for the car parks. You'll need to enter your booking reference or take a ticket at the entrance barrier. Keep the ticket or booking confirmation with you.

4. Parking: Proceed to the designated car park and find an available parking space. Make sure to park within the marked bays and adhere to any parking restrictions or instructions displayed.

5. Terminal Access: If your car park is not within walking distance of the terminal, you may need to take a shuttle bus to reach the terminal building. Shuttle bus stops are usually located within the car park or a short walk from it.

6. Payment: If you didn't prepay for parking, you'll need to make the payment before leaving the car park. Payment machines are typically located near the exit barriers or in the terminal building. You can pay using cash, credit/debit cards, or contactless payment methods.

7. Departure: When you're ready to leave, return to your car and drive to the exit barrier. Insert the ticket or scan the QR code from your booking confirmation to open the barrier and exit the car park.

It's always advisable to check the Luton Airport website or contact the airport directly for the latest information and any changes to parking procedures or prices.
